Fargo Police Warn Citizens of Felony Lane Gang

 

Over the last decade, the United States has been hit by a theft ring called Felony Lane Gang where suspects break into unattended vehicles in parking lots targeting purses containing cash, credit cards, checkbooks, and I.D.’s.  In January 2018, Fargo had at least 12 cases linked to this nationwide ring. While in Fargo, the suspects targeted fitness centers, daycares, movie theaters, sporting events, cemeteries, and parks. Seven arrests, including one juvenile, were made in connection to incidents from Florida to North Dakota. Recently, similar incidents have occurred elsewhere in North Dakota, and in the region. The Fargo Police Department would like to remind everyone to remove valuables from your vehicles when running errands, going to the gym or dropping your children off at daycare. If you are victim of a theft of this nature, please remember to cancel debit cards, credit cards and checks.
